Auschwitz-Birkenau concentration camp

Opened on June 14, 1940, Auschwitz is the largest concentration camp and extermination complex of the Third Reich. It is located on the territory of the localities of Oświęcim (Auschwitz in German) and Brzezinka (Birkenau in German), annexed to the Reich (province of Silesia) after the invasion of Poland. It was liberated by the Red Army on January 27, 1945.
